Understanding Dark Humor
At its core, dark humor jokes juxtaposes morbid or controversial topics with comedic elements. This contrast often results in a jarring yet humorous effect, prompting laughter amidst discomfort. Historically, dark humor has been used as a coping mechanism during trying times, allowing individuals to process trauma through levity. The rise of dark humor jokes 2024 and dark humor jokes 2025 indicates a growing acceptance and evolution of this comedic style. However, the line between humor and offense remains subjective, varying across cultures and individuals.

b. Jokes About Depression
Dark humor jokes about depression can serve as coping mechanisms for some, offering a way to process personal struggles. However, they can also trivialize mental health issues, leading to misunderstandings. It's essential to differentiate between self-deprecating humor and content that stigmatizes mental illness. As awareness grows, so does the call for sensitive handling of such topics in comedy. Balancing humor with empathy is key.
